The Costa Blanca offers numerous beaches that are specially tailored to the needs of people with reduced mobility.
The barrier-free facilities are accessible for disabled persons and are usually available from July to September, in some cases a reservation is required.
All beaches have wooden walkways, adapted sanitary facilities and amphibious wheelchairs.
Playa del Arenal is the only sandy beach in Jávea to offer comprehensive barrier-free facilities. A specially equipped area in the southern section of the beach is looked after by the local Red Cross station and provides amphibious wheelchairs and walking aids. There are also adapted toilets with shower and changing facilities. The free service is available daily from 11:00 to 19:00 between 1 July and 15 September, but requires a reservation.
